If you have a rich condition while idling, that is from a too large pilot. The pilot and only the pilot jet supply fuel during the idle curcuit. Keep in mind that what summit800 stated about drilling out your needle jet. The pilot does control the idle curcuit, but it also supplies about 10% of fuel flow at wide open.
Since you are reducing the pilot jet down in size, you must increase the needle jet size to accomodate for the extra fuel needed now at wide open.
With your evaluation of higher altitudes, it just solidify's the theory that your pilot jet is way too rich. the higher you go, the less fuel you need.
